Database API¶
-
class
tango.
Database
¶ Database is the high level Tango object which contains the link to the static database. Database provides methods for all database commands : get_device_property(), put_device_property(), info(), etc.. To create a Database, use the default constructor. Example:
db = Database()
The constructor uses the TANGO_HOST env. variable to determine which instance of the Database to connect to.

add_device
(self, dev_info) → None¶ Add a device to the database. The device name, server and class are specified in the DbDevInfo structure
- Example
dev_info = DbDevInfo() dev_info.name = 'my/own/device' dev_info._class = 'MyDevice' dev_info.server = 'MyServer/test' db.add_device(dev_info)
- Parameters
- dev_info
(
DbDevInfo
) device information
- Return
None

add_server
(self, servname, dev_info, with_dserver=False) → None¶ Add a (group of) devices to the database. This is considered as a low level call because it may render the database inconsistent if it is not used properly.
If with_dserver parameter is set to False (default), this call will only register the given dev_info(s). You should include in the list of dev_info an entry to the usually hidden DServer device.
If with_dserver parameter is set to True, the call will add an additional DServer device if it is not included in the dev_info parameter.
Example using with_dserver=True:
dev_info1 = DbDevInfo() dev_info1.name = 'my/own/device' dev_info1._class = 'MyDevice' dev_info1.server = 'MyServer/test' db.add_server(dev_info1.server, dev_info, with_dserver=True)
Same example using with_dserver=False:
dev_info1 = DbDevInfo() dev_info1.name = 'my/own/device' dev_info1._class = 'MyDevice' dev_info1.server = 'MyServer/test' dev_info2 = DbDevInfo() dev_info1.name = 'dserver/' + dev_info1.server dev_info1._class = 'DServer dev_info1.server = dev_info1.server dev_info = dev_info1, dev_info2 db.add_server(dev_info1.server, dev_info)
New in version 8.1.7: added with_dserver parameter

get_attribute_alias_list
(self, filter) → DbDatum¶ Get attribute alias list. The parameter alias is a string to filter the alias list returned. Wildcard (*) is supported. For instance, if the string alias passed as the method parameter is initialised with only the * character, all the defined attribute alias will be returned. If there is no alias with the given filter, the returned array will have a 0 size.
- Parameters
- filter
(
str
) attribute alias filter
- Return
DbDatum containing the list of matching attribute alias

get_device_property_list
(self, dev_name, wildcard, array=None) → DbData¶ Query the database for a list of properties defined for the specified device and which match the specified wildcard. If array parameter is given, it must be an object implementing de ‘append’ method. If given, it is filled with the matching property names. If not given the method returns a new DbDatum containing the matching property names.
New in PyTango 7.0.0
- Parameters
- Return
if container is None, return is a new DbDatum containing the matching property names. Otherwise returns the given array filled with the property names

class
tango.
DbDatum
¶ A single database value which has a name, type, address and value and methods for inserting and extracting C++ native types. This is the fundamental type for specifying database properties. Every property has a name and has one or more values associated with it. A status flag indicates if there is data in the DbDatum object or not. An additional flag allows the user to activate exceptions.
- Note: DbDatum is extended to support the python sequence API.
This way the DbDatum behaves like a sequence of strings. This allows the user to work with a DbDatum as if it was working with the old list of strings.
New in PyTango 7.0.0
